Experience the thrill of high-speed mountain biking through indigenous forests or dive the depths of the lagoon. Hire a kayak to tour the winding Knysna river, or – for an aerial view – raise the heartbeat with an abseil above the ocean’s crashing waves. Quad bike along a dusty path or ride a horse along the water's edge. Try fly fishing, rock-and-surf angling or deep-sea fishing. Or, for the daring, dune-surf down sandy waves, kite-surf on the waters of the lagoon or paraglide over the hills and lakes.

Ride the Outeniqua Choo-Tjoe – one of Africa’s last steam train services. Take a cruise across the lagoon or out to sea on a stylish yacht or a ferry. Hire a bicycle and tour the town ...or visit the Elephant Park and experience a closeness with nature unlike anything you’ve ever felt before.

Encircled by reserves and situated within a national park – in Knysna, there's nature wherever you look. The Knysna forests and the Indian Ocean, the Cape fynbos, freshwater lakes, saltwater lagoons and tidal estuaries are all easy to explore by car or on foot.
